Doors stacks (with hair flipping at all) are still around at USC, though Panhellenic is working to make them safer for the actives (e.g. doing a workshop on how to do a safe door stack).

Lawn dances/porch songs are no longer allowed on campus for slideshow day though.

USC is (slowly) moving towards making its recruitment more "no-frills." There was talk about banning door stacks this year but it was decided that lawn dances/porch songs would be banned instead.

ETA every chapter at USC does door stacks & hair flipping. I personally don't get the appeal of it.
